- 1、本文档共31页,可阅读全部内容。
- 2、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 5、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 6、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 7、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 8、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
**********************使用框架框架为软件开发提供基础结构和指导方针,帮助开发者构建可靠、可维护的应用程序。什么是框架代码结构框架为开发人员提供预先构建的代码结构和组件。它就像一个建筑蓝图,定义了应用程序的组织方式。复用性框架包含可重用的代码模块和组件。开发人员可以利用这些组件来构建应用程序的功能,而无需从头开始编写所有代码。框架的优点代码复用框架提供预定义组件和模块,简化开发,提高效率。结构化组织框架为项目提供清晰的结构和组织,便于维护和扩展。安全保障框架通常包含安全机制,帮助开发者构建安全的应用程序。易于调试框架的结构化设计便于调试和解决问题,减少开发成本。主流框架介绍11.ReactReact是由Facebook开发的一种JavaScript库,专注于构建用户界面。22.AngularAngular是由Google开发的一个强大的JavaScript框架,提供完整的前端解决方案。33.VueVue是一个渐进式JavaScript框架,易于学习和使用,适合各种规模的项目。React框架简介声明式编程React使用声明式编程方式,描述用户界面应该是什么样子。组件化React将UI分解为独立的组件,每个组件都负责渲染自己的一部分UI。虚拟DOMReact使用虚拟DOM来提高渲染效率,只更新改变的部分。数据绑定React使用单向数据绑定,数据只能从父组件流向子组件。Angular框架简介组件化Angular框架采用组件化开发模式,可复用性高,易于维护。Google背书由Google维护,拥有强大的社区支持和丰富的文档资源。TypeScript支持使用TypeScript语言,提供强类型检查和代码提示,提高代码质量。Vue轻量级Vue.js是一个渐进式框架,可以根据项目需求选择使用功能。易于学习Vue.js的语法简单,易于理解和使用,适合初学者。灵活Vue.js的灵活性允许开发者根据项目需求定制功能,并与其他库和框架集成。活跃社区Vue.js拥有庞大而活跃的社区,提供丰富的文档、教程和支持。React框架简介React是一个由Facebook开发的JavaScript库,用于构建用户界面。它采用组件化思想,将用户界面分解成独立的、可复用的组件。React的虚拟DOM和单向数据流机制,提高了性能和可维护性。React组件可复用性组件是React应用的核心,封装了UI的特定部分,例如按钮、文本框或导航栏。组件可以被重复使用,减少代码重复,提高代码可维护性。可组合性组件可以互相嵌套,形成更复杂的UI结构。例如,一个导航栏组件可以包含多个按钮组件。数据管理每个组件可以拥有自己的状态,用于存储和管理数据。组件之间可以通过props传递数据,实现数据共享和通信。React生命周期1初始化组件首次渲染,并执行构造函数和渲染方法。2更新组件状态或属性发生变化时,触发更新过程,重新渲染组件。3销毁组件从DOM中移除时,触发销毁方法,释放资源。React事件处理11.事件监听器React使用`addEventListener`方法将事件监听器绑定到组件元素上。22.事件处理函数当事件发生时,会触发与之关联的事件处理函数。33.事件对象事件对象包含有关事件的详细信息,例如事件类型和目标元素。44.事件合成React使用事件合成机制,统一了不同浏览器之间的事件处理差异。React状态管理ReduxRedux是一种流行的状态管理库,它提供了一种可预测的状态更新方法。ContextAPIContextAPI是React内置的机制,用于在组件之间共享数据。MobXMobX是一个基于可观察对象的库,它简化了状态管理的复杂性。React样式处理CSSModulesCSSModules提供一个简单且强大的方法,通过隔离样式来提高样式的安全性。StyledComponentsStyledComponents允许您将样式直接写入组件,使代码更易于阅读和维护。内联样式内联样式适用于简单的样式,但对于复杂的样式可能难以维护。StyledJSXStyledJSX是React的一种方法,允许您在组件中使用JavaScript编写CSS。React路由系统ReactRouterReactRouter是一个广泛使用的库,它
文档评论(0)